Toroidal configurations with a quadrupole-like separatrix are discussed. The configurations are produced by superposing a quadrupole field and a pair of radial transform fields on a toroidal field. They may have magnetic shears close to unity. The radial transform fields are produced by planer spiral coils which may be fabricated much more accurately than toroidal-helical coils and also leave the side of the torus accessible.
